Overview

The Haibike Trekking 4 2024 is a versatile all-terrain e-bike designed for mixed-surface riding, offering a balance of off-road confidence and everyday practicality. With a powerful 600W motor and 75Nm of torque, it provides strong assistance for hills and longer rides, supported by a large 720Wh battery that delivers above-average range. The removable battery adds convenience for charging and storage, while hydraulic disc brakes offer reliable stopping power. However, the bike’s heavier weight may make it slightly harder to lift, and the lack of detailed ride mode options could affect how smoothly the motor support feels in different conditions.

eBike FAQs

Is this bike suitable for long rides on mixed terrain?

The Haibike Trekking 4 2024 is well-suited for long rides on mixed terrain, thanks to its powerful 600W motor and 75Nm of torque, which provide strong assistance for hills and varied surfaces. With a large 720Wh battery, it offers above-average range, making it reliable for extended trips. However, its heavier weight might make it slightly more challenging to lift, and the lack of detailed ride mode options could affect how smoothly the motor support feels in different conditions.

How does the motor perform when climbing hills?

The motor should provide strong support when climbing hills, thanks to its 75 Nm of torque, which is above average for similar e-bikes. However, the power delivery may feel less refined, especially if you're looking for smooth and adjustable assist levels. Overall, it should handle moderate to steep inclines well, making it a solid choice for mixed-terrain riding.
